Konecranes Named Preferred Supplier for EMCO Maier USA



Konecranes Machine Tool Service (MTS) has been named the preferred machine tool service provider for EMCO Maier USA, a European manufacturer of machine tools.

EMCO USA has chosen Konecranes MTS as its preferred OEM Service Support for the North American market based on a continuous ongoing relationship with the company. Konecranes MTS has employees with over 20 years of experience servicing and repairing EMCO equipment.

"Konecranes MTS is a great resource for technical, mechanical and electrical knowledge, and they are EMCO equipment certified," said Philipp Hauser, President, EMCO USA.

"Konecranes MTS is a leading service provider for all types and brands of machine tools in the manufacturing industry," said a company spokesperson. "Its extensive service offering includes machine rebuilds, remanufacturing, retrofitting, preventative maintenance and service repair."

Konecranes MTS specialists include control engineers, alignment/calibration experts and scraping specialists. The company can provide a customized maintenance package for each customer's specific needs, regardless of machine type, size and volume.
